Town Center Bank provides various financial services to individuals and businesses in Illinois. Town Center Bank was founded in 2006 and is based in New Lenox, Illinois. Town Center operates under BanksRegional classification in the United States and is traded on OTC Exchange.

8 Steps to conduct Town Center's Valuation Analysis

OTC Stock's valuation is the process of determining the worth of any otc stock in monetary terms. It estimates Town Center's potential worth based on factors such as financial performance, market conditions, growth prospects, and overall economic environment. The result of otc stock valuation is a single number representing a OTC Stock's current market value. This value can be used as a benchmark for various financial transactions such as mergers and acquisitions, initial public offerings (IPOs), or private equity investments. To conduct Town Center's valuation analysis, follow these 8 steps:
  • Gather financial information: Obtain Town Center's financial statements, including balance sheets, income statements, and cash flow statements.
  • Determine Town Center's revenue streams: Identify Town Center's primary sources of revenue, including products or services offered, target markets, and pricing strategies.
  • Analyze market data: Research Town Center's industry and market trends, including the size of the market, growth rate, and competition.
  • Establish Town Center's growth potential: Evaluate Town Center's management, business model, and growth potential.
  • Determine Town Center's financial performance: Analyze its financial statements to assess its historical performance and future potential.
  • Choose a valuation method: Consider the OTC Stock's specific circumstances and choose an appropriate valuation method, such as the discounted cash flow (DCF) or comparable analysis method.
  • Calculate the value: Apply the chosen valuation method to the financial information and market data to calculate Town Center's estimated value.
  • Review and adjust: Review the results and make necessary adjustments, considering any relevant factors that may have been missed or overlooked.
Note: This is a general outline, and different approaches and methods may be used depending on the type and size of the otc stock being valued. We also recomment to seek professional assistance to ensure accuracy.

Town Center Growth Indicators

Growth stocks usually refer to those companies expected to grow sales and earnings faster than the market average. Growth stocks typically don't pay dividends, often look expensive, and usually trading at a high P/E ratio. Nevertheless, such valuations could be relatively cheap if the company continues to grow, which will drive the share price up. However, since most investors are paying a high price for a growth stock, based on expectations, if those expectations are not fully realized, growth stocks can see dramatic declines.
